Storyboarding is the procedure of unleashing your creative thinking to fill out the voids and think of how the video clip will look as a finished item. Storyboards cover a great deal of info, from particular shots and angles to cam motions to choosing the ideal focal length. And due to the fact that storyboards can be developed into hard duplicates, you can share this visualization with your team or your customers to see to it every person is on the exact same web page (and what you desire for the job is what you finish up shooting on the day).


And with storyboards done, you'll have the ability to identify what electronic camera tools, lighting devices, and audio equipment you require for the manufacturing. The requirements of your production will vary based on budget plan and extent, or even the kind of video you're making. If you're a material maker, maybe all you need is some iPhone videography devices; if you're shooting an occasion, you might require to work with an internal tech team to learn what you need.
